About The Organization Star Union Dai-ichi Life Insurance (SUD Life) is a joint venture formed in 2007 between two major Indian PSU banks - Bank of India and Union Bank of India - and Japan's Dai-ichi Life Holdings.

We have served over 15 million customers through more than 19,500 bank branches across India. Our network includes 1,950 rural bank branches, ensuring insurance reaches remote areas.

SUD Life focuses on creating insurance products that meet different customer needs across all segments of society. With our promoters' 100+ years of commitment and combined strengths, we aim to become a leading name in India's life insurance sector while delivering value to all stakeholders.

Established in 1902, Dai-ichi Life is the second largest life insurance company of Japan and is one of the top ten life insurers globally, renowned for sound product knowledge, superior asset management skills, and strong operational capabilities to manage life insurance businesses.

About The Role Role: Technical Lead - Data & AI Function: IT – Strategy, Digital & AI

Role Level: Manager

Experience: 5–7 years

Employment Type: Full-time

Role Overview

We are looking for a technically robust and delivery-oriented Manager for the IT Data & AI team who can own end-to-end API development, cloud-enabled application integration, infrastructure coordination, and application governance. The ideal candidate should be hands-on with modern technology stacks while also being capable of managing internal teams, vendor-driven applications, security tracks, and operational uptime for business-critical platforms.

This role requires a balanced mix of technical depth, team leadership, vendor governance, cloud exposure, and production operations discipline. The candidate should be able to design, build, govern, monitor, and continuously improve APIs and related systems across multiple technologies while ensuring scalability, security, and reliability.

Key Responsibilities API Development & Integration Ownership

- Own end-to-end API development lifecycle including requirement understanding, solution design, development, testing, deployment, documentation, versioning,



and production support.
- Design and develop secure, scalable, and high-performance APIs across different technology stacks, including RESTful APIs, microservices, and integration services.
- Define API standards, reusable templates, naming conventions, authentication mechanisms, logging practices, and documentation norms.
- Work closely with business teams, data engineering teams, application teams, and external partners to enable seamless system-to-system integrations.
- Ensure APIs are built with proper error handling, monitoring, retry logic, throttling, access control, and performance optimization.

Team Management & Technical Governance

- Manage and guide a team of developers, engineers, and support resources responsible for API development, monitoring, maintenance, and enhancement.
- Review technical designs, code quality, deployment readiness, release plans, and production support processes.
- Set up governance processes for API inventory, ownership, documentation, access controls, monitoring dashboards, and periodic health reviews.
- Ensure adherence to internal IT processes, change management, incident management, vulnerability remediation, and audit requirements.
- Mentor team members on modern engineering practices, cloud technologies, secure coding, automation, and operational excellence.

Application Supervision & Vendor Management

- Supervise vendor-driven applications owned or supported by the Data & AI team, ensuring timely delivery, stability, compliance, and production readiness.
- Track vendor deliverables, open issues, release plans, defects, SLAs, escalations, and closure status.
- Coordinate with vendors for application enhancements, bug fixes, regression testing, deployment planning, and post-production support.
- Ensure applications are aligned with enterprise architecture, security standards, infrastructure norms, and business continuity expectations.
- Drive structured reviews with vendors and internal stakeholders to ensure accountability, transparency, and measurable outcomes.

VAPT, Security & Compliance Governance

- Own and govern the VAPT track for applications, APIs, servers, and platforms under the Data & AI team.
- Coordinate with information security, infrastructure, vendors, and application teams for vulnerability identification, remediation, retesting, and closure.
- Track security observations, risk ratings, target dates, exception approvals, and audit evidence.
- Ensure API and application development follows secure coding, access management, data protection, encryption, authentication, and authorization best practices.




- Maintain compliance documentation and periodic status reporting for management reviews, audits, and internal governance forums.

Cloud, Infrastructure & Server Uptime Management

- Coordinate provisioning and management of infrastructure required for APIs, applications, data platforms, and AI-related workloads.
- Work with cloud and infrastructure teams to manage environments across Azure and GCP, including compute, storage, networking, identity, access, monitoring, and backup requirements.
- Track internal server uptime, performance, capacity, patches, alerts, incidents, and preventive maintenance activities.
- Ensure proper monitoring, logging, alerting, and escalation mechanisms are in place for production systems.
- Support cloud adoption, modernization, automation, and cost-conscious infrastructure planning for Data & AI initiatives.

Required Technical Skills

- Strong hands-on experience in API development, integration architecture, microservices, REST APIs, JSON, authentication, and API security.
- Working knowledge of cloud platforms, especially Microsoft Azure and Google Cloud Platform.
- Exposure to cloud services such as compute, storage, networking, identity management, serverless services, monitoring, logging, and security controls.
- Good understanding of application deployment, CI/CD practices, DevOps ways of working, version control, release management, and environment management.
- Experience with databases, SQL, application integrations, data flows, and basic data engineering concepts.
- Understanding of VAPT, vulnerability remediation, secure coding practices, access controls, encryption, audit trails, and security governance.
- Ability to read, review, and challenge technical designs, architecture documents, API specifications, and vendor solution proposals.

Preferred Skills

- Experience in insurance, BFSI, fintech, or regulated enterprise technology environments.
- Exposure to API gateways, Azure API Management, Apigee, Kong, MuleSoft, or similar integration platforms.
- Knowledge of containers, Kubernetes, Docker, serverless architecture, event-driven integrations, and cloud-native design patterns.
- Understanding of data platforms, analytics systems, AI/ML application integration, and enterprise reporting ecosystems.
- Certifications in Azure, GCP, cloud architecture, DevOps, security, or API management will be an added advantage.

Qualification & Experience

-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, Data Science, or a related discipline.
- 5–7 years of relevant experience in API development, application integration, cloud technology, infrastructure coordination, or application support governance.
- Minimum 2–3 years of hands-on experience in API development or application integration projects.
- Experience in managing small technical teams, vendors, production applications, and cross-functional IT initiatives.
- Prior experience in regulated environments with security, audit, VAPT, and compliance requirements will be preferred.
